## Deploying the Gatewick Proctor Queue

Deploys are pretty painless: push to main, wait for the pipeline, then watch the queue drain dashboard for five minutes. If candidates pile up mid-exam, roll back first and ask questions later — the queue replays safely. Everything the workers care about lives in one config block, shown here for reference.

settings of bafof-yagef:
JOROX_PIN=8740
JOROX_TENANT=pelox
JOROX_METRICS_HOST=metrics.jorox.qorvelworks.internal
JOROX_SEAL=seal_c78f63c1
JOROX_STANDBY_TEAM=norax

Welcome to the Tumblebin review rotation! Quick context: our laundry-locker access flow lets residents unlock a bin via the FreshDrop app, which pings the locker gateway for a one-time door token. When reviewing PRs, check that nobody logs the token payload — that's bitten us twice. Local setup is easy: copy `env.sample` to `.env`, point `LOCKER_GATEWAY_URL` at the Plover staging cluster, and set your test building ID. The gateway's shared credential goes on the line directly below this sentence.

env line for tawig-kadup: VAULT_KEY5=07c4f

- [ ] Confirm the Lanthorn nightly reindex completed before 04:00 and shard counts match yesterday's baseline within 1%. If the job is still running, do not restart it; page the search lead instead. Record completion status in the handoff doc alongside the reindex build token shown below.

session token of yahof-bajeg = htk9_0d43d44ed

## Key Ceremony Checklist — Ormgrove Refactor

- [ ] Confirm both custodians are present before re-signing the migration bundle for the legacy Ormgrove ORM cutover. The signing appliance will prompt for the ceremony passphrase after inserting the custodian token. Support staff witnessing the ceremony should verify it matches the value below:

vault phrase of fawif-haduf = wenwyn-briath

Account Recovery — Pagewright Static Builds

If a customer loses access to their Pagewright dashboard, incremental rebuilds of their static site will continue from the last known-good deploy, so no content is lost during recovery. Confirm the customer's last rebuild timestamp in the Orlin console, then initiate the recovery flow from the admin panel. Do not trigger a full rebuild until access is restored. Unlocking the recovery flow requires the passphrase below.

recovery phrase for yadup-taguf: wenael-quenox-kelix